Wagner Claims Fifth Consecutive MAAC Water Polo Championship
No. 1 Wagner College - 10 | No. 2 Marist College - 7
2018 Water Polo Championship Game
McCann Natatorium | Poughkeepsie, NY
No. 1 Wagner College (24-6) knocked off No. 2 Marist College (20-17), 10-7, to claim its fifth consecutive MAAC Water Polo Championship. The Seahawks have won a MAAC record eight Water Polo Championships.
Wagner Notes:
- Six of Wagner’s eight MAAC Championship title game victories have come against Marist (2018, 2017, 2016, 2015, 2014, 2007).
- Since April 12, 2015, the Seahawks are 44-0 against conference foes.
- Senior utility Kimberly Watson was named the 2018 MAAC Water Polo Championship MVP. The utility takes home the championship MVP honor for the second year in a row. Over the course of two games, the senior found the back of the net seven times to lead the Seahawks scoring attack. In today’s win, Watson notched three goals, four drawn exclusions, and three steals.
- Sophomore attack Jacqui Sjoren and freshman goalie Katherine Campbell were named members of the All-Championship Team. Sjogren scored four goals to lead all scorers in the championship finale. Campbell made five saves and posted a .417 save-percentage in net this afternoon.
- Junior attack Erica Hardy totaled three points (two goals, one assist) and drew an exclusion.
- The Seahawks shot .345 percent and went 4-9 on powerplays.
- Wagner earns the leagues’ automatic bid to the 2018 NCAA Women’s Water Polo Championship. The 2018 NCAA Women’s Water Polo selection show will be streamed on NCAA.com tomorrow, April 30, at 8 p.m.
Marist Notes:
- Senior goalie Jessica Hermosillo and senior defender Diana Carballo were named to the All-Championship Team.
- Carballo led the Red Foxes with five points (three goals, two assists) in the game.
- Hermosillo made eight saves, had a .444 save-percentage, and swiped two steals.
- Senior utility Katherine Tijerina finished the game with two goals, three steals, and two drawn exclusions.
